System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 语音对讲方法、系统、电子设备和可读存储介质技术方案_技高网

语音对讲方法、系统、电子设备和可读存储介质技术方案

技术编号:41419666 阅读:2 留言:0更新日期:2024-05-28 20:20
本发明专利技术提供一种语音对讲方法、系统、电子设备和可读存储介质,涉及监控技术领域,所述方法包括:获取第三用户发出的第一呼叫请求,并将所述第一呼叫请求发送至与本机摄像设备相关联的第一用户设备,以建立本机摄像设备与所述第一用户设备之间的第一会话;将所述第一呼叫请求转发至检测到的至少一个第二摄像设备,以使所述至少一个第二摄像设备通知各自关联的第二用户设备加入至所述第一会话,解决了现有技术中无法基于摄像设备实现多个用户之间的通话的技术问题。

【技术实现步骤摘要】

本专利技术涉及监控,尤其涉及一种语音对讲方法、系统、电子设备和可读存储介质


技术介绍

1、在现有技术中,摄像设备具有双向语音的基础功能,可以实现设备端与应用端的语音通话,即只能实现两个用户之间的通话,而无法实现多个用户之间的通话。

2、因此,如何基于摄像设备实现多个用户之间的通话,是相关领域技术人员亟待解决的技术问题。


技术实现思路

1、本专利技术提供一种语音对讲方法、系统、电子设备和可读存储介质,用以解决现有技术中无法基于摄像设备实现多个用户之间的通话的技术问题。

2、本专利技术提供第一种语音对讲方法,应用于第一摄像设备,所述方法包括:

3、获取第三用户发出的第一呼叫请求,并将所述第一呼叫请求发送至与本机摄像设备相关联的第一用户设备,以建立本机摄像设备与所述第一用户设备之间的第一会话;

4、将所述第一呼叫请求转发至检测到的至少一个第二摄像设备,以使所述至少一个第二摄像设备通知各自关联的第二用户设备加入至所述第一会话。

5、根据本专利技术提供的第一种语音对讲方法,所述方法还包括:

6、采集第三用户发出的第三用户语音,将所述第三用户语音发送至所述第一用户设备,并接收所述第一用户设备发送的第一用户语音;

7、将所述第一用户语音转发至所述至少一个第二摄像设备,以使所述至少一个第二摄像设备将所述第一用户语音转发至各自关联的第二用户设备;

8、接收并播放所述至少一个第二摄像设备转发的第二用户语音,所述第二用户语音表示与所述第二摄像设备相关联的第二用户设备发送的语音。

9、根据本专利技术提供的第一种语音对讲方法,所述方法还包括:

10、在检测到所述第三用户的当前位置与本机摄像设备之间的第一距离大于预设的第一距离阈值的情况下,发送第一语音获取请求至所述至少一个第二摄像设备;

11、接收所述至少一个第二摄像设备采集的第三用户发出的第三用户语音,并将所述第三用户语音发送至所述第一用户设备。

12、本专利技术提供第二种语音对讲方法,应用于第二摄像设备,所述方法包括:

13、在接收到第一摄像设备转发的第一呼叫请求的情况下,发送第二呼叫请求至与本机摄像设备相关联的第二用户设备,以建立本机摄像设备与所述第二用户设备之间的第二会话;

14、基于所述第二会话将所述第一呼叫请求转发至所述第二用户设备,以通知所述第二用户设备加入至所述第一摄像设备与第一用户设备对应的第一会话。

15、根据本专利技术提供的第二种语音对讲方法,所述方法还包括:

16、获取第一用户设备发送的第一用户语音以及第三用户发出的第三用户语音;所述第一用户语音表示与第一摄像设备相关联的第一用户设备发送的语音;

17、将所述第一用户语音和所述第三用户语音,转发至与本机摄像设备相关联的第二用户设备;

18、接收所述第二用户设备发送的第二用户语音,并将所述第二用户语音发送至所述第一摄像设备。

19、根据本专利技术提供的第二种语音对讲方法,所述获取第一用户设备发送的第一用户语音以及第三用户发出的第三用户语音,包括:

20、启动本机摄像设备的音频采集模块,以采集所述第三用户所处环境中的当前语音信息,并从所述当前语音信息中获取所述第一用户语音和第三用户语音;

21、或者,发送第二语音获取请求至第一摄像设备,并接收第一摄像设备发送的第一用户语音和第三用户语音。

22、根据本专利技术提供的第二种语音对讲方法,在所述启动本机摄像设备的音频采集模块之后,所述方法还包括:

23、发送音频获取请求至所述第一摄像设备,以获取第一摄像设备采集的第三用户发出的第一语音数据;

24、采集第三用户发出的第二语音数据,并基于所述第一语音数据中的时间戳从所述第二语音数据中截取第二语音数据段;

25、基于所述第一语音数据中的第一语音数据段和所述第二语音数据段,将本机摄像设备中的音频采集模块的当前音量调整至预设音量范围内。

26、根据本专利技术提供的第二种语音对讲方法,所述方法还包括:

27、在接收到所述第一摄像设备发送的第一语音获取请求的情况下,检测所述第三用户的当前位置与本机摄像设备之间的第二距离;

28、在确定所述第二距离小于预设的第二距离阈值的情况下,采集第三用户发出的第三用户语音,并将采集到的所述第三用户语音转发至所述第一摄像设备。

29、本专利技术还提供一种语音对讲系统,包括:第一摄像设备以及至少一个第二摄像设备,所述第一摄像设备与所述至少一个第二摄像设备通信连接;

30、所述第一摄像设备与第一用户设备相关联,用于执行如上述第一种所述的语音对讲方法;

31、所述至少一个第二摄像设备中的每一个第二摄像设备与一个第二用户设备相关联,用于执行如上述第二种所述的语音对讲方法。

32、本专利技术还提供一种电子设备,包括存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,所述处理器执行所述程序时实现如上述第一种所述的语音对讲方法或者如上述第二种所述的语音对讲方法。

33、本专利技术还提供一种非暂态计算机可读存储介质,其上存储有计算机程序,该计算机程序被处理器执行时实现如上述第一种所述的语音对讲方法或者如上述第二种所述的语音对讲方法。

34、本专利技术提供的语音对讲方法、系统、电子设备和可读存储介质,通过第一摄像设备将第三用户发出的第一呼叫请求发送至第一用户设备,以建立第一摄像设备与第一用户设备之间的第一会话,并通过第一摄像设备将第一呼叫请求转发至检测到的至少一个第二摄像设备,以使至少一个第二摄像设备通知各自关联的第二用户设备加入至第一会话,从而可以基于第一会话实现第一用户设备对应的第一用户、第三用户以及第二用户设备对应的第二用户之间的多用户通话,从而解决了现有技术中无法基于摄像设备实现多个用户之间的通话的技术问题。

本文档来自技高网...

【技术保护点】

1.一种语音对讲方法,其特征在于,应用于第一摄像设备,所述方法包括:

2.根据权利要求1所述的语音对讲方法,其特征在于,所述方法还包括:

3.根据权利要求1或2所述的语音对讲方法,其特征在于,所述方法还包括:

4.一种语音对讲方法,其特征在于,应用于第二摄像设备,所述方法包括:

5.根据权利要求4所述的语音对讲方法,其特征在于,所述方法还包括:

6.根据权利要求5所述的语音对讲方法,其特征在于,所述获取第一用户设备发送的第一用户语音以及第三用户发出的第三用户语音,包括:

7.根据权利要求6所述的语音对讲方法,其特征在于,在所述启动本机摄像设备的音频采集模块之后,所述方法还包括:

8.根据权利要求5所述的语音对讲方法,其特征在于,所述方法还包括:

9.一种语音对讲系统,其特征在于,包括:第一摄像设备以及至少一个第二摄像设备,所述第一摄像设备与所述至少一个第二摄像设备通信连接;

10.一种电子设备,包括存储器、处理器及存储在所述存储器上并可在所述处理器上运行的计算机程序,其特征在于,所述处理器执行所述程序时实现如权利要求1至3任一项所述的语音对讲方法或者如权利要求4至8任一项所述的语音对讲方法。

11.一种非暂态计算机可读存储介质,其上存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现如权利要求1至3任一项所述的语音对讲方法或者如权利要求4至8任一项所述的语音对讲方法。

...

【技术特征摘要】

1.一种语音对讲方法,其特征在于,应用于第一摄像设备,所述方法包括:

2.根据权利要求1所述的语音对讲方法,其特征在于,所述方法还包括:

3.根据权利要求1或2所述的语音对讲方法,其特征在于,所述方法还包括:

4.一种语音对讲方法,其特征在于,应用于第二摄像设备,所述方法包括:

5.根据权利要求4所述的语音对讲方法,其特征在于,所述方法还包括:

6.根据权利要求5所述的语音对讲方法,其特征在于,所述获取第一用户设备发送的第一用户语音以及第三用户发出的第三用户语音,包括:

7.根据权利要求6所述的语音对讲方法,其特征在于,在所述启动本机摄像设备的音频采集模块之后,所述方法还包括:<...

【专利技术属性】
技术研发人员:陆益祝接金
申请(专利权)人:浙江宇视科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1